seajs加载jquery时提示$ is not a function该怎么解决


Posted in Javascript onOctober 23, 2015

jquery1.7以上的都支持模块化加载,只是jquery默认的是支持amd,不支持cmd。所以要用seajs加载jquery时,我们需要稍微做下改动,需要把以下内容做下修改,具体修改方式如下:

if (typeof define === "function" && (define.amd)) {
   define( "jquery", [], function() {
     return jQuery;
   });
 }

改成

if (typeof define === "function" && (define.amd || define.cmd)) {
   define( "jquery", [], function() {
     return jQuery;
   });
 }

if (typeof define === "function") {
   define( "jquery", [], function() {
     return jQuery;
   });
 }

通过以上代码的修改就可以成功解决seajs加载jquery时提示$ is not a function问题,希望对大家有所帮助。

Javascript 相关文章推荐
js获取location.href的参数实例代码
Aug 02 Javascript
js hover 定时器(实例代码)
Nov 12 Javascript
JS运动基础框架实例分析
Mar 03 Javascript
jQuery获取URL请求参数的方法
Jul 18 Javascript
GitHub上一些实用的JavaScript的文件压缩解压缩库推荐
Mar 13 Javascript
AngularJS基础 ng-dblclick 指令用法
Aug 01 Javascript
详解webpack之scss和postcss-loader的配置
Jan 09 Javascript
vue指令只能输入正数并且只能输入一个小数点的方法
Jun 08 Javascript
vue中v-for循环给标签属性赋值的方法
Oct 18 Javascript
angular 实现下拉列表组件的示例代码
Mar 09 Javascript
Jquery让form表单异步提交代码实现
Nov 14 jQuery
three.js显示中文字体与tween应用详析
Jan 04 Javascript
浅析Node.js 中 Stream API 的使用
Oct 23 #Javascript
jQuery实现右侧显示可向左滑动展示的深色QQ客服效果代码
Oct 23 #Javascript
js显示当前日期时间和星期几
Oct 22 #Javascript
js检测用户输入密码强度
Oct 22 #Javascript
使用JQuery实现Ctrl+Enter提交表单的方法
Oct 22 #Javascript
实例详解angularjs和ajax的结合使用
Oct 22 #Javascript
jQuery多级手风琴菜单实例讲解
Oct 22 #Javascript
You might like
dedecms中显示数字验证码的修改方法
2007/03/21 PHP
让你成为更出色的PHP开发者的10个技巧
2011/02/25 PHP
php入门学习知识点二 PHP简单的分页过程与原理
2011/07/14 PHP
将FCKeditor导入PHP+SMARTY的实现方法
2015/01/15 PHP
通过php删除xml文档内容的方法
2015/01/23 PHP
Laravel框架实现修改登录和注册接口数据返回格式的方法
2018/08/17 PHP
javascript取消文本选定的实现代码
2010/11/14 Javascript
javascript中有趣的反柯里化深入分析
2012/12/05 Javascript
jquery animate实现鼠标放上去显示离开隐藏效果
2013/07/21 Javascript
js对象内部访问this修饰的成员函数示例
2014/04/27 Javascript
Knockoutjs 学习系列(二)花式捆绑
2016/06/07 Javascript
bootstrap下拉框动态赋值方法
2018/08/10 Javascript
详解jQuery-each()方法
2019/03/13 jQuery
js中的深浅拷贝问题简析
2019/05/10 Javascript
解决vue字符串换行问题(绝对管用)
2020/08/06 Javascript
ES6 十大特性简介
2020/12/09 Javascript
[01:59][TI9趣味视频] 全明星赛奖励
2019/08/23 DOTA
Python3基础之函数用法
2014/08/13 Python
使用Nginx+uWsgi实现Python的Django框架站点动静分离
2016/03/21 Python
python基础之入门必看操作
2017/07/26 Python
python如何实现视频转代码视频
2019/06/17 Python
在django模板中实现超链接配置
2019/08/21 Python
Python数据正态性检验实现过程
2020/04/18 Python
python IDLE添加行号显示教程
2020/04/25 Python
python的json包位置及用法总结
2020/06/21 Python
CSS3 实现童年的纸飞机
2019/05/05 HTML / CSS
HTML5实现的图片无限加载的瀑布流效果另带边框圆角阴影
2014/03/07 HTML / CSS
HTML5 解决苹果手机不能自动播放音乐问题
2017/12/27 HTML / CSS
详解如何解决canvas图片getImageData,toDataURL跨域问题
2018/09/17 HTML / CSS
Sunglasses Shop荷兰站:英国最大的太阳镜独立在线零售商和供应商
2017/01/08 全球购物
后勤部经理岗位职责
2014/02/23 职场文书
法律顾问服务方案
2014/05/15 职场文书
数学考试作弊检讨书300字
2015/02/16 职场文书
党支部创先争优公开承诺书
2015/04/30 职场文书
2016大学军训心得体会
2016/01/11 职场文书
Nginx进程调度问题详解
2021/09/25 Servers